Best Scheduling for Dance Studios: Top 5 Tools in 2026

Dance studio owners juggle multiple class schedules, student recitals, private lessons, costume fittings, and parent-teacher conferences—all while managing different age groups, skill levels, and instructor availability. Without the right scheduling system, you'll spend hours managing booking conflicts, sending reminder texts, and fielding phone calls from parents trying to swap classes. The right scheduling software eliminates double-bookings, automates parent communications, handles recurring class enrollments, and integrates payment collection for tuition and registration fees.

What to Look For in Scheduling Software for Dance Studios

Dance studios have unique scheduling requirements that go beyond simple appointment booking. You need software that handles recurring weekly classes across multiple age groups and skill levels (Tiny Tots on Tuesday mornings, Teen Hip-Hop on Thursday evenings), manages drop-in classes versus committed term enrollments, and accommodates both group sessions and private lessons. Look for platforms that support class capacity limits—critical when you have 15 spots in Ballet I but 30 parents trying to register—and waitlist management for popular instructors or time slots.

Payment integration is non-negotiable for dance studios. Your scheduling tool should seamlessly collect registration fees, monthly tuition, costume deposits, and recital ticket purchases. The best systems integrate with Stripe or Square to process payments automatically when parents book classes, eliminating the administrative burden of chasing down tuition checks. Additionally, prioritize tools with robust reminder systems—SMS and email notifications reduce no-shows for trial classes and keep parents informed about schedule changes, recital rehearsals, or studio closures.

Staff management features matter tremendously when you're coordinating multiple instructors with varying specialties and availability. You need calendar systems that allow instructors to block off unavailable times, support round-robin assignment for trial lessons, and display which teacher is leading each class. Mobile accessibility is crucial since dance instructors often check schedules between classes or while traveling to competitions. Parent-facing booking pages should be simple enough for non-tech-savvy grandparents to reserve a spot in Granddaughter's jazz class without calling the front desk.

Avoid the common mistake of choosing enterprise-level scheduling platforms designed for corporate meetings—they lack class capacity management, recurring enrollment features, and the ability to organize schedules by age group or dance style. Similarly, don't settle for basic appointment tools that can't handle the complexity of seasonal registration periods (fall term, spring recital prep, summer intensives) or family account management where one parent books classes for multiple children. The right tool should feel purpose-built for activity-based businesses with recurring group sessions, not just one-on-one consultations.

Top Scheduling Tools for Dance Studios

Acuity Scheduling

Acuity Scheduling

Acuity Scheduling excels for dance studios because it handles both recurring class enrollments and one-time bookings like trial lessons or private coaching sessions. The platform's class capacity management prevents overbooking in group sessions, while customizable intake forms let you collect essential information like student age, dance experience, injury history, and costume sizes during registration.

Use Cases for Dance Studios

  • Managing recurring weekly ballet, jazz, tap, and hip-hop classes with automatic enrollment and payment collection
  • Scheduling private lessons with specific instructors while blocking off their rehearsal and competition travel time
  • Collecting registration fees, costume deposits, and recital ticket payments through integrated Stripe or PayPal processing
  • Sending automated reminders to parents about upcoming classes, recital rehearsals, and picture day appointments

Pros

  • +Robust class capacity limits and waitlist management prevent overcrowding in age-specific sessions
  • +Seamless payment integration collects tuition, registration fees, and deposits automatically during booking
  • +Customizable intake forms gather student information, medical considerations, and parent emergency contacts upfront

Cons

  • -Higher monthly cost compared to simpler booking tools, though justified for studios with multiple instructors
  • -Initial setup requires time to configure class types, instructor schedules, and pricing tiers for different age groups

💲 Starting at $16/month for emerging studios, the Growing plan ($27/month) suits studios with 2-3 instructors, while larger academies benefit from the Powerhouse tier ($49/month) with unlimited calendar connections.

Vagaro

Vagaro

Vagaro is purpose-built for service-based businesses like dance studios, offering an all-in-one solution that combines scheduling, point-of-sale, and marketing tools in one platform. The built-in marketplace helps attract new students searching for local dance classes, while the family account management makes it easy for parents to book and pay for multiple children from one login.

Use Cases for Dance Studios

  • Managing term-based enrollment for fall, spring, and summer sessions with automatic recurring billing for monthly tuition
  • Running promotional campaigns and email marketing to fill spots in new class offerings or summer intensives
  • Processing retail sales for dancewear, shoes, and costume accessories alongside class bookings
  • Tracking instructor schedules, commission on private lessons, and substitute teacher assignments

Pros

  • +Free tier available for solo instructors or small studios just starting out with online booking
  • +Built-in marketplace feature drives new student discovery and trial class bookings from local searches
  • +Comprehensive business management including inventory tracking for dancewear and retail merchandise sales

Cons

  • -Transaction fees apply on lower-tier plans, which can add up with high-volume monthly tuition processing
  • -Feature-rich interface may feel overwhelming for studio owners who only need basic class scheduling

💲 The free plan works for solo dance instructors, while established studios typically need Top Pro ($25/month) or Top Pro Unlimited ($55/month) to eliminate transaction fees and access advanced marketing tools.

Setmore

Setmore

Setmore offers dance studios a budget-friendly scheduling solution with unlimited appointments on the free plan, making it ideal for smaller studios or those just transitioning from paper calendars. The platform's class booking capabilities, Facebook integration for easy parent access, and Square payment processing create a streamlined booking experience without overwhelming complexity.

Use Cases for Dance Studios

  • Scheduling group classes with capacity limits for different age divisions and skill levels
  • Accepting bookings directly through your Facebook and Instagram pages where parents already engage with your studio
  • Managing multiple instructor calendars for studios with specialized teachers for ballet, contemporary, and acrobatics
  • Collecting payment for drop-in classes, workshops, and masterclass events through Square integration

Pros

  • +Generous free plan with unlimited appointments makes it accessible for new or budget-conscious studios
  • +Strong social media integration allows parents to book classes without leaving Facebook or Instagram
  • +Intuitive mobile app lets instructors and studio managers update schedules from anywhere

Cons

  • -Advanced features like staff management and detailed reporting require paid Pro upgrades
  • -Customization options are more limited compared to specialized dance studio management platforms

💲 The free plan handles unlimited bookings for small studios, while the Pro plan at $5/user/month adds features like intake forms and staff management for growing academies.

Square Appointments

Square Appointments

Square Appointments is perfect for dance studios already using Square for retail sales of dancewear, shoes, and costumes, creating a unified system for class bookings and merchandise transactions. The integrated payment processing means parents can pay tuition and registration fees seamlessly while booking, and the no-show protection with card-on-file helps reduce lost revenue from forgotten trial classes.

Use Cases for Dance Studios

  • Managing class schedules alongside retail sales of dance shoes, leotards, and recital costumes in one system
  • Processing monthly tuition payments automatically with card-on-file for enrolled students
  • Reducing no-shows for trial classes and parent conferences with automated reminders and deposit requirements
  • Creating staff schedules for multiple instructors teaching different dance styles across various time slots

Pros

  • +Seamless integration with Square POS for studios selling dancewear and merchandise alongside class offerings
  • +No-show protection through card-on-file requirements helps reduce lost revenue from forgotten appointments
  • +Free tier provides robust scheduling for single instructors or very small studios

Cons

  • -Premium features for multiple staff members require paid plans that increase costs as you add instructors
  • -Best suited for Square ecosystem users; less flexible if you prefer alternative payment processors

💲 Free for single-instructor studios, Plus ($29/month per location) suits studios with 2-4 teachers, while Premium ($69/month) supports larger academies with extensive staff and advanced features.

SimplyBook.me

SimplyBook.me

SimplyBook.me stands out for dance studios with complex scheduling needs, offering 150+ features including class booking, instructor management, and membership packages for seasonal terms. The platform's extensive customization allows you to create distinct booking flows for trial classes, recurring enrollments, private lessons, and special events like recital rehearsals or parent observation days.

Use Cases for Dance Studios

  • Creating membership packages for fall term, spring term, and summer intensive enrollments with automated recurring billing
  • Managing multiple studio locations with different class schedules, instructors, and room assignments
  • Offering online class booking in multiple languages for diverse communities with international families
  • Scheduling complex recital preparation with costume fittings, photo day appointments, and rehearsal blocks

Pros

  • +Extensive feature set handles complex scenarios like multi-location studios, membership packages, and resource booking
  • +Free plan available for solo instructors with unlimited bookings to test the platform
  • +Multi-language support accommodates studios serving diverse, multilingual communities

Cons

  • -Overwhelming number of features creates a steeper learning curve compared to simpler booking tools
  • -Some advanced features require separate paid add-ons beyond the base subscription cost

💲 Free for solo instructors, Basic ($8.25/month) suits small studios, Standard ($24.90/month) accommodates growing academies, and Premium ($49.90/month) supports large multi-location operations with advanced needs.

Pricing Comparison

ToolStarting PricePricing Note
Acuity Scheduling$16/moStarting at $16/month for emerging studios, the Growing plan ($27/month) suits studios with 2-3 instructors, while larger academies benefit from the Powerhouse tier ($49/month) with unlimited calendar connections.
VagaroFreeThe free plan works for solo dance instructors, while established studios typically need Top Pro ($25/month) or Top Pro Unlimited ($55/month) to eliminate transaction fees and access advanced marketing tools.
SetmoreFreeThe free plan handles unlimited bookings for small studios, while the Pro plan at $5/user/month adds features like intake forms and staff management for growing academies.
Square AppointmentsFreeFree for single-instructor studios, Plus ($29/month per location) suits studios with 2-4 teachers, while Premium ($69/month) supports larger academies with extensive staff and advanced features.
SimplyBook.meFreeFree for solo instructors, Basic ($8.25/month) suits small studios, Standard ($24.90/month) accommodates growing academies, and Premium ($49.90/month) supports large multi-location operations with advanced needs.

Get Your Free Software Recommendation

Answer a few quick questions and we'll match you with the perfect tools

1/4

Select the category that best fits your needs

Scheduling

Frequently Asked Questions

What scheduling features are essential for managing recurring dance class enrollments?

Look for scheduling software that supports recurring appointments with automatic enrollment for term-based schedules (fall, spring, summer sessions). The system should handle class capacity limits to prevent overbooking age-specific sessions, offer waitlist management for popular time slots, and integrate payment processing for automatic monthly tuition collection. Family account management is crucial so parents can register multiple children without creating separate logins for each student.

How can scheduling software reduce no-shows for trial dance classes?

Automated SMS and email reminders sent 24-48 hours before scheduled trial classes significantly reduce no-shows. Many scheduling platforms also offer no-show protection through card-on-file requirements or small deposit collection during booking, which increases commitment. The best systems allow you to customize reminder messages with studio-specific details like what to wear, parking instructions, and what to expect in the first class.

Can dance studio scheduling software handle both group classes and private lessons?

Yes, the best scheduling tools for dance studios support both group class bookings with capacity limits and one-on-one private lesson scheduling. Look for platforms that allow you to set different pricing structures, booking rules, and duration for group sessions versus private instruction. Advanced systems also support round-robin assignment to distribute trial lessons evenly among instructors or let students request specific teachers for private coaching.

What payment features should dance studio scheduling software include?

Essential payment features include integration with processors like Stripe, Square, or PayPal to collect registration fees, monthly tuition, costume deposits, and recital ticket purchases during booking. The system should support recurring billing for ongoing enrollments, one-time payments for drop-in classes or workshops, and partial payment options for expensive items like competition fees. Family account billing that consolidates charges for multiple students under one parent account saves significant administrative time.

How do I manage multiple instructors with different specialties in scheduling software?

Choose scheduling platforms with robust staff management features that allow each instructor to set their availability, block off time for competitions or personal commitments, and display which dance styles they teach. The system should support instructor-specific booking pages for private lessons while also showing combined schedules for group classes. Look for calendar views that color-code instructors and allow you to filter by teacher, dance style, age group, or skill level for easy schedule oversight.

Can scheduling software help organize recital rehearsals and costume fittings?

Yes, comprehensive scheduling tools allow you to create special event types for recital-related activities beyond regular classes. You can set up time slots for costume fittings with specific duration, schedule photo day appointments for different age groups, and block rehearsal time with capacity limits for full cast run-throughs. Automated reminders ensure parents receive details about what to bring, when to arrive, and any special instructions for these non-regular activities.

What's the difference between appointment scheduling and class management software for dance studios?

Basic appointment scheduling tools focus on one-on-one bookings and simple calendar management, while class management software designed for dance studios handles group sessions with capacity limits, term-based enrollments, recurring weekly schedules, and family accounts. Dance-specific platforms typically include features like skill level tracking, age group filtering, instructor specialties, and seasonal registration periods that generic appointment schedulers lack. Studios with primarily group classes need class management capabilities, not just individual appointment booking.

More Scheduling Guides